# Break-Glass: Catalog Cache Invalidation

Scope: the Pinrow product catalog at Veldstone Retail. If stale prices persist after a purge and the Hollowmere invalidation queue is wedged, use break-glass to flush the edge tier directly. Contractors: get verbal sign-off from the catalog lead first. Steps: open the Hollowmere admin shell, select emergency-flush, confirm the tenant, and run it once — repeated flushes thrash the origin. Access is logged and expires after 20 minutes. Unseal the admin shell with the passphrase below.

recovery phrase for kahop-tajog: istix-casvan

Onboarding note — image slimming review. Our Parebin pipeline rebuilds every service image on a distroless base, dropping shells, package managers, and build tooling before signing. Reviewers should verify the final layer manifest matches the signed attestation in the Kestrelgate registry. Attestations themselves sit in a sealed vault; audit access requires unsealing it once per review cycle. The recovery passphrase used for that unseal is below.

recovery phrase for fajep-yaweg: gilath-sorox-wenius-rusdor-keliel-zorius

To all branch managers: the draft training budget for next year allocates 420 hours per branch, a 12% increase over the current allocation. Priority goes to certification on the Merrow stock platform and refresher sessions for seasonal staff at the Aldgrove and Finchery branches. Travel-based courses are being phased out in favour of regional hubs; expect fewer overnight allowances.

Submit your branch's headcount projections by the end of the month so figures can be finalised.

Please note the item below.

management briefing: Sorvanox Systems plans to raise the Zorwyn list price by 27.2 percent in December. The pricing group signed off on a budget of $101.7 million for Project Casox. The renewal with Pramirix Foods closes at $183.4 million a year, 63.5 percent above the last contract. Project Holdor slips by one quarter because of the tooling delay.

☐ Key ceremony, step 4 — GalleryEcho audio-guide signing key. Before we mint the new content-signing key for the museum app, double-check that both custodians are present and the old key is marked retired in the registry (yes, actually check, don't just nod). The HSM session will prompt once; that's expected. When it asks to unseal the backup shard, type the recovery passphrase shown just below.

strongbox words: eliius-pelath-sorius-oliys-noviel